Zyklophin is a semisynthetic peptide derived from dynorphin A and a highly selective antagonist of the κ-opioid receptor (KOR).[1][2] It is systemically-active, displaying good metabolic stability and blood-brain-barrier penetration.[2] Similarly to other KOR antagonists, it has been shown to block stress-induced reinstatement of cocaine-seeking in animals.[2]
